Ekinops ONE421

The ONE421 guarantees 100Mbps bi-directional routing performance (IMIX409) with real-world services. The WiFi interface includes two radio chipsets to manage concurrently WiFi in the 2.4 and 5GHz frequency bands. WiFi reach and throughput is significantly increased by the number of antennas: 802.11b/g/n is supported by a 3×3 antenna system, while the 802.11a/ac relies on 4×4 MIMO. The MU-MIMO brings an additional improvement in throughput by multiplexing data streams of multiple users when they are spatially separated. The Ethernet switch ensures non-blocking switching at Gigabit speed between LAN and WiFi users.

RICi-E3

RICi-E3 Fast Ethernet over E3 Intelligent Converter

RICi-E3 are intelligent converters connecting Fast Ethernet LANs over E3 circuits. They enable service providers and ISPs to supply transparent Ethernet services, without interfering with user traffic.

  • Transparent user traffic and secure management, via double VLAN tagging
  • Three levels of QoS, based on VLAN priority queues as per IEEE 802.1p
  • Inband and out-of-band management
  • Monitoring and statistics collection of TDM and Ethernet ports
  • Fault propagation of E3 error conditions to the Ethernet port
